Study of High Sensitive Troponin-I Level in End-stage Renal Disease Patients Receiving Hemodialysis
NCT02572466 · Status: COMPLETED · Type: OBSERVATIONAL · Enrollment: 207
Last updated 2016-01-29
Summary
This study objective is to compare the high sensitive troponin-I level in end-stage renal disease patients received hemodialysis without acute cardiovascular event with healthy population. The investigators also determine the effect of hemodialysis on troponin I level as the secondary objective.
